About Lianming Kang
Lianming Kang is a scholar working on Cardiology and Cardiovascular Medicine, Developmental Neuroscience and Emergency Medicine, having authored 29 papers that have together received 294 indexed citations. Recurring topics across this work include Cardiomyopathy and Myosin Studies (20 papers), Cardiovascular Function and Risk Factors (12 papers) and Cardiac Structural Anomalies and Repair (6 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(249 citations), Developmental Neuroscience (18 citations) and Emergency Medicine (12 citations). Lianming Kang has collaborated with scholars based in China and United States. Frequent co-authors include Jizheng Wang, Lei Song, Yubao Zou, Rutai Hui, Jie Liu, Yilu Wang, Dong Wang, Shihua Zhao, Yuejin Yang and Shiqin Yu. Their work appears in journals such as Radiology, International Journal of Molecular Sciences and Heart.
